Ticket NF-883, blocking review of the fan-out backpressure patch. The Thrushline secrets vault sealed during maintenance, so the reviewer can't pull the load-test credentials to reproduce the queue saturation numbers. Unseal manually rather than waiting for ops. The vault CLI asks for the team recovery passphrase on manual unseal; it is listed below.

recovery phrase for bajop-tahaf: kasael-istmir-kaseth-oliwyn-aldax-pelael-ralius

## Formula sandbox tuning

User-supplied formulas in Gridmoor execute inside a restricted interpreter with hard ceilings on time, memory, and call depth. Reviewers should confirm any change to these ceilings is justified in the PR description, since raising them widens the abuse surface. Defaults were chosen from production traces. The current limits are as follows.

limits module of tafog-fawip:
WEIGHTS = {
    "julix": 57,
    "lamys": 992,
    "kasvan": 209,
    "quenok": 750,
    "alddor": 259,
    "oliath": 1009,
    "wenix": 815,
}

Hey Marit,

Wrapping up my rotation on GraphWeave, our dependency graph visualizer. The cycle-detection pass is still flaky on graphs over 10k nodes — I bumped the worker timeout as a stopgap, but someone should profile the layout engine properly. Also, the Tuesday cache flush job overlaps with the nightly render; I staggered them by an hour. Everything else is quiet. Notes are in the team wiki under "GraphWeave oncall".

Future maintainers: if anything here stops making sense, reach out to the platform tooling group directly.

— Joss

billing contact of fawep-tadug = fraath_druox@nelvrocorp.corp

To the release manager: I'm passing ownership of the Pellwick deep-link router to Sorrel before the 4.2 cut. The intent-matching table now lives in the Farrowgate config service; stale entries were purged last sprint. Watch the fallback route — it silently swallows malformed slugs, which inflated our drop-off metrics in March. The staging resolver needs its keystore unlocked before each regression pass, and that keystore accepts only one credential. For the signing vault, the recovery phrase is noted directly below.

recovery phrase for tafog-fafog: novix-novdor-fraath-brieth-olieth-oliix-rusix-wenion-julax-druox